Our today's diary is dedicated to the legendary ZIS-3 and its place in Soldiers: Arena. This is the cannon that was the most massively used in the RKKA, and one of the few that were used with equal success both in the division and anti-tank artillery.
Soviet soldiers, for the simplicity and reliability tenderly called her - "Zosia". For the rate of fire (up to 25 shots in a minute) the abbreviation was sometimes deciphered as “Zalp imeni Stalina” (Volley named after Stalin), while Wehrmacht soldiers called the cannon «Ratsch-Bumm» - «Ratchet", because the sound of the projectile, flying on supersonic speed, came some earlier than the sound of the shot (and it seems, they heard them often… when looking on the number of issued cannons). ZIS-3 was the world's first artillery cannon which has been put on the conveyor. 48 016 of it were produced in the version of divisional cannon and 18 601 - in the modification of the gun for SU-76 and SU-76M. This number makes the ZIS-3 a champion in the history of artillery, because no cannon in the world, either before or after "Zosia" had not been produced in such numbers.

Such figures were achieved, above all, due to the optimization of production. As Grabin (chief designer) would later write in his book "Design of the details should be so simple that they can be processed using simplest devices and simplest tool. And another condition: mechanisms and units should be collected individually and consist of nodes, which gather independently. The main factor in all the work became the economic demands with the unconditional preservation of service qualities of the cannon."

And the quality was maintained. Prior to 1943, ZIS-3 on the distance of fire of 500-700 meters was able to pierce in the front part almost any sample of German armored vehicles with rare exceptions (eg, StuG III Ausf F with a 80-mm frontal armor). Against the later medium and heavy tanks, this cannon was practically useless when shooting in the front. But since replacing it in the required quantity wasn’t possible, it continued to be used in anti-tank forces.

For example a significant advantage of the artillery over the tanks and AT SPG’s, is their "invisibility". In Soldiers: Arena cannons, machine guns, and artillery, as a whole, will be "light up" significantly less while shooting, so this gives them a chance against more mobile machinery.
ZIS-3 is accessible, inexpensive cannon, which is great for the early and mid game. The big advantage of it, is the relative ease, making it possible to move with the the help of artillery crew only. It is just like its real analogue has little to oppose to middle and nothing - to heavy tanks, but has enough features to stomp in the mud enemy light vehicles and infantry, rooted in the buildings. But it’s main function is to support the infantry, both in defense and offense. You know, Soldiers: Arena is a team game and you can do nothing without a proper support!
